What are some common signs of roof damage?

Common roof damage indicators:
  • Leaks or Water Stains: Water stains on ceilings or walls, dripping water, or dampness in the attic.
  • Missing, Cracked, or Curled Shingles: Inspect for damaged or missing shingles, especially after a storm.
  • Damaged Flashing: Look for rust, corrosion, or gaps in flashing around chimneys, vents, or skylights.
  • Sagging or Uneven Rooflines: A sagging roof could indicate structural problems.
  • Granule Loss: Excessive granules in gutters suggest aging asphalt shingles.
  • Moss or Algae Growth: Can trap moisture and damage roofing materials.

What is the difference between a roof overlay and a roof tear-off?

When replacing a roof, there are two main approaches:
Roof Overlay: Installing a new layer of roofing material over the existing roof. It's less expensive and faster, but not always ideal.
Roof Tear-Off: Completely removing the existing roofing before installing a new one. More labor-intensive but allows for inspection and repairs to the roof deck.
A tear-off is typically preferred, but a roofing contractor can advise on the best approach for your situation.

What is a soffit, and why is it important for my roof?

The soffit is the underside of the roof overhang that connects the roof edge to the exterior wall. It's important for:
  • Ventilation: Soffit vents provide intake ventilation, allowing fresh air to enter the attic and regulate temperature and moisture.
  • Aesthetics: It creates a finished look to the roof's underside.
  • Pest Control: A properly sealed soffit prevents pests like birds and squirrels from nesting in the attic.
Keeping your soffit in good condition is crucial for a healthy and functional roof.

How do I choose the right roofing materials for my home?

Choosing the right roofing materials for your home depends on several factors:
  • Style: Consider your home's architectural style and choose a roofing material that complements it.
  • Climate: Factor in your local climate conditions. Some materials perform better in extreme heat, cold, or high winds than others.
  • Budget: Roofing materials have a wide range of costs. Determine your budget and choose materials that fit your financial constraints.
  • Durability and Lifespan: Assess the expected lifespan and durability of different materials.
  • Energy Efficiency: Choose materials with good insulation and reflectivity properties to improve your home's energy efficiency.
A reputable roofing contractor can provide expert advice on suitable roofing materials for your specific situation.
